Who Issues Fair Play Certifications?


Fair play certifications are issued by specialised independent organisations that audit gaming systems and software.


Well-known testing and certification bodies

  • eCOGRA: Focuses on player protection, fairness testing, and dispute resolution

  • iTech Labs: Provides RNG testing and certification for online casinos globally

  • GLI: Covers compliance testing, technical standards, and certification across multiple jurisdictions

  • BMM Testlabs: Specialises in compliance, RNG testing, and regulatory certification

  • Technical Systems Testing (TST): A long-standing gaming test lab (often referenced in regulatory lab lists alongside GLI) that has provided game testing and RNG certification services


These organisations operate independently, helping ensure evaluations are unbiased and technically grounded.


What Do Fair Play Certifications Test?


Certification involves multiple layers of testing to support fairness, accuracy, and reliable operation.


Random Number Generator (RNG) testing

  • Verifies outcomes are random and unpredictable

  • Checks for bias or detectable patterns

  • Confirms independence of results over time


Payout accuracy (RTP)

  • Validates that the game’s return-to-player (RTP) is implemented as declared

  • Focuses on long-run behaviour (often supported by math/code review plus testing)


System integrity

  • Checks that software is not tampered with

  • Confirms secure and stable operation


Game logic

  • Verifies rules are applied correctly

  • Checks for unintended biases or incorrect behaviour


Together, these checks help confirm that games behave the way the operator and provider claim they do.


How RNG Testing Works (Simplified)


RNG testing is one of the most important parts of fair play certification.


What is RNG?

  • A system that generates random outcomes

  • Used in slots, roulette, and many digital casino games


How it is tested

  • Large volumes of RNG output are analysed using statistical tests

  • Testing looks for bias, predictability, or patterns

  • Results are checked against expected probability distributions


Why it matters

  • Supports fairness and consistency

  • Helps prevent manipulation

  • Reduces the risk of “rigged” or predictable outcomes

What Certifications Do NOT Guarantee


While important, fair play certifications have limitations.


They do NOT guarantee

  • That you will win

  • Short-term outcomes

  • Absence of losses

  • Personal profitability


Certifications focus on fairness and correct implementation—not on giving players an advantage.

How to Identify Fair Play Certifications


Most certified platforms display their certification details clearly—if they’re legitimate.


Where to look

  • Website footer

  • About, Compliance, or Licensing pages

  • Game provider information sections


What to check

  • Certification logos and the name of the testing lab

  • Whether the certificate ID or audit reference is shown

  • Whether the certification can be verified on the lab’s website


Fake sites may paste logos without approval, so it’s best to verify the claim rather than trusting the image alone.


Common Misconceptions About Fair Play


Many players misunderstand what certifications actually mean.


Myth: Certified games are easier to win

  • Reality: They’re tested to be fair, not favourable


Myth: Certification removes risk

  • Reality: Randomness still means wins and losses happen


Myth: All platforms are certified

  • Reality: Certification varies by operator, provider, and jurisdiction
